TurboTax gives you an estimated date for receiving your refund based on a 21 day average from your date of acceptance, but it can take longer. Many refunds are taking longer during the pandemic.
First, check your e-file status to see if your return was accepted:

If accepted, they try to process it within three weeks but it can be longer. if you have earned income credit or additional child tax credit, it will be at least the end of February before you see your refund, due to the PATH act that requires that they hold your refund longer.
Once your federal return has been accepted by the IRS, only the IRS has any control. TurboTax does not receive any updates from the IRS. Your ONLY source of information about your refund now is the IRS.
You need your filing status, your Social Security number and the exact amount (line 34of your 2020 Form 1040) of your federal refund to track your Federal refund:

If you chose to have your TurboTax fees deducted from your federal refund, that will take some extra time, while the third party bank handles the refund processing.

According to Turbo Tax my my tax return was "accepted " by the IRS on 3/1/2021,but when I checked on 3/5/2021 they had no record of the acceptance. What do I do now since the IRS probably misplaced my return.
How does the IRS locate a return that they misplaced after they said it was accepted?
@Gossamer You might be worried unnecessarily. The IRS refund site is behaving erratically. We have been seeing quite a few users whose information is not showing up on the refund site even though the IRS accepted the return and is working on it. Check the site again after the weekend--sometimes they do maintenance on Sundays.
